Output b0676177a6fe0ef8a40c903067153a3fd598db95c900e51db1e829fd3f4ef131:20

value
403509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86aa5216621c4063115eede761b4a9f685a033a OP_EQUAL
address
3QLXFwmNWP8wKCSKMWChQmDjg4p38PGniG
transaction
b0676177a6fe0ef8a40c903067153a3fd598db95c900e51db1e829fd3f4ef131
spent
true